Forest Grove Police Log excerpt, 27 November 2019

The selection from the log of local police activity for this week is all in a panic.
November 18
Officers converged on a fast food restaurant after a panic alarm had been pushed numerous times. Police found an employee who admitted he did not know what the button was for, and pushed it out of curiosity. The manager was advised to ensure all employees were familiar with the alarm.
